理解OffsetTop与CSS布局的关系:提升网页交互体验的关键因素 (理解OFDMA的原理含义及应用范围)

技术教程9个月前发布 howgotuijian
502 0 0
机灵助手免费chatgpt中文版

理解OffsetTop与CSS布局的关系

在现代网页开发中,网页的交互体验越来越受到重视。用户体验的提升不仅依赖于页面的美观程度,还与页面的布局和元素的交互方式密切相关。本文将深入分析OffsetTop在CSS布局中的作用,并探讨其对网页交互体验的影响。

OffsetTop是DOM(文档对象模型)中一个重要的属性。它可以帮助开发者获取某个元素距离其最近的定位父元素的顶部边缘的距离。在CSS布局中,不同的定位方式(如静态、相对、绝对和固定定位)会影响OffsetTop的值,这直接关系到元素在页面上的表现。理解这些关系不仅有助于开发者更好地控制页面元素的位置,还能够为用户提供更加流畅和直观的交互体验。

OffsetTop与CSS布局的关系体现在元素的定位。CSS布局通常涉及多个层级的嵌套结构,每个元素可能会受到其父元素的影响。OffsetTop可以帮助开发者明确某个元素在整个文档流中的位置,特别是在使用绝对定位或固定定位时,OffsetTop值的调整可以直接影响到用户如何与这些元素交互。例如,一个按钮的OffsetTop值可能决定了它在下拉菜单中的显示位置,进而影响用户的点击体验。

OffsetTop在处理动态效果时也占有重要地位。很多现代Web应用都采用了动态加载和滚动效果,OffsetTop可以用于判断元素是否在视口中,从而控制元素的出现与消失。通过监听滚动事件,开发者可以使用OffsetTop值来判断用户的滚动方向和位置,进而实现如“回到顶部”或“加载更多内容”的功能。这种基于OffsetTop的动态交互方式显著提升了用户体验,使得网页更加生动与响应迅速。

OffsetTop还与响应式设计息息相关。在多种设备上访问网页时,元素的排版和位置可能会因屏幕大小的不同而有所变化。使用OffsetTop属性,开发者可以灵活控制元素在不同设备上的位置。例如,通过媒体查询调整某个元素的Margin或Padding属性,再结合OffsetTop的计算,可以确保元素在各种屏幕上都能保持良好的对齐和间距,从而提升跨设备的用户体验。

理解OffsetTop的作用与应用,能够帮助开发者在构建更复杂的布局时,做出更合理的设计决策。比如在建立一个带有多个重叠层的模态窗口时,OffsetTop可以用于确定哪个元素应该最上层,从而不影响用户与其它控件的交互。这样的布局控制可以避免因元素层级错乱而导致的用户体验问题,确保界面的一致性和直观性。

OffsetTop在CSS布局中的应用是非常广泛的。它不仅为网页元素的定位和显示提供了重要依据,同时在提升网站交互体验方面也扮演了不可或缺的角色。掌握OffsetTop的特性和应用,可以帮助开发者更好地设计和实现用户友好的网页,使用户在浏览与操作时能获得更加愉悦的体验。因此,在进行网页开发时,深入理解OffsetTop与CSS布局之间的关系,是提升网页交互体验的关键因素

© 版权声明
机灵助手免费chatgpt中文版

相关文章

暂无评论

您必须登录才能参与评论!
立即登录
暂无评论...